China Power & Distribution Transformer Market plays a crucial role in the infrastructure development. Huge amount is funded in its power grid infrastructure to improve its power transformers and catering the increasing population demand for electricity. Further, the increasing demand for electricity, government initiatives to improve the power supply in remote areas, and the growing renewable energy sector are the key growth proliferating aspects of the market.
Below mentioned are some major drivers and their impacts on the market dynamics:
| Drivers | Primary Segments Affected | Why it matters (evidence) |
| Renewable Energy Expansion | Power Transformer | Large scale projects such as solar and wind projects in Inner Mongolia, Xinjiang, and Gansu demand robust transformers for grid connection and power transmission. |
| Grid Modernization Programs | Power & Distribution Transformers | Nationwide investment in smart grids and UHV (Ultra High Voltage) projects enhances demand for advanced and high-capacity transformers. |
| Rapid Industrialization | Distribution Transformer | Expanding manufacturing zones and industrial parks require continuous and stable power, fuelling demand for medium-capacity transformers. |
| Urbanization & Smart City Projects | Distribution Transformer | Construction of smart buildings and metro systems is growing in cities like Shanghai and Shenzhen drives transformer deployment for urban distribution networks. |
| Electrification of Transport & EV Infrastructure | Power & Distribution Transformers | Developments of EV charging networks and transport electrification increases the need for efficient and high-performance transformers. |

Below mentioned some major restraints and their influence on the market dynamics:
| Restraints | Primary Segments Affected | What this means (evidence) |
| Raw Material Price Volatility | Power & Distribution Transformers | Due to fluctuations in the prices of steel, copper, and insulation materials, production and installation costs grows. |
| Grid Congestion Issues | Power Transformer | Uneven power distribution across regions delays transformer integration and grid optimization. |
| Technological Gaps in Rural Regions | Distribution Transformer | There is limited adoption of modern transformer technology in remote provinces slows nationwide grid efficiency. |
| Environmental Concerns | Liquid Type Transformers | SF6-based and oil-filled transformers face stricter environmental regulations, prompting a shift toward eco-friendly alternatives. |
| Intense Market Competition | All Categories | Competition is high among numerous local manufacturers that reduces the profit margins and increases pricing pressure. |
China Power & Distribution Transformer Market is dealing with some major challenges which need to be addressed such as rising material costs, regulatory compliance for eco-friendly designs, and intense domestic competition among manufacturers. Further, to balance the rapid urban grid expansion with rural electrification remains a major problem. Furthermore, there is need for advanced manufacturing technologies and digital monitoring solutions to meet the smart grid requirements adds further investment pressures.

According to Chinese Government Data, has introduced policies to promote energy efficiency, grid stability, and carbon neutrality. Under the 14th Five-Year Plan for Electric Power Development, strict standards for transformer energy efficiency, insulation performance, and environmental safety are enforced. Regulations under the National Energy Administration (NEA) and the State Grid Corporation of China (SGCC) promote green grid technologies and digital power management systems. Moreover, subsidies for renewable energy integration projects and incentives for low-loss transformer designs further support market expansion.
The future of China Power & Distribution Transformer Market Growth is predicted to rise with gradual investments in smart grid modernization, renewable integration, and eco-efficient manufacturing. Digital monitoring technologies are adopted in huge amount, combined with the government’s carbon neutrality targets, will transform transformer production and operation. Furthermore, the dominance of China in global power equipment exports positions it as a leader in sustainable grid infrastructure development through 2031.

According to Vasu, Senior Research Analyst, 6Wresearch, between two types, power transformer is expected to lead the market with their extensive use in large-scale transmission projects, renewable power integration, and ultra-high-voltage applications. The government’s continuous expansion of the national grid and cross-province power transfer systems boosts demand for high-capacity power transformers.
The 50.1 MVA- 160 MVA range dominates the market as it supports regional substations and renewable integration projects. These transformers are critical for grid stability, particularly in renewable-heavy regions like Inner Mongolia and Qinghai.
In the distribution transformer category, the 315.1 kVA- 5 MVA range are likely to hold the largest share due to its deployment in urban and industrial distribution networks. Its ability to handle variable loads efficiently makes it ideal for smart grid applications and manufacturing clusters.
Liquid Type Transformer is predicted to lead the market due to its superior cooling efficiency and reliability for high-capacity operations. It is widely adopted in substations, heavy industries, and renewable transmission systems, offering enhanced performance under China’s high-load grid conditions.
Among applications, power utilities lead the market due to large-scale investments by the State Grid Corporation of China (SGCC) and China Southern Power Grid (CSPG). Ongoing grid automation projects, substation expansions, and renewable power connections are driving demand for efficient and smart transformers in this segment.
